千鶴的開(kāi)發(fā)日記(千鶴項(xiàng)目迭代開(kāi)發(fā)隨記一則初稿完成紀(jì)要)

來(lái)源:證券時(shí)報(bào)網(wǎng)作者:
字號(hào)

技術(shù)難題的解決

隨著開(kāi)發(fā)的?深入,我們面臨了一系列技術(shù)難題。從系統(tǒng)架構(gòu)的設(shè)計(jì)到具體功能的實(shí)現(xiàn),每一個(gè)環(huán)節(jié)都充滿(mǎn)了挑戰(zhàn)。特別是在系統(tǒng)架構(gòu)的設(shè)計(jì)階段,我們需要在高性能和高可擴(kuò)展性之間找到平衡。為此,我們進(jìn)行了大量的文獻(xiàn)調(diào)研和技術(shù)對(duì)比,最終選擇了一個(gè)能夠滿(mǎn)足我們需求的架構(gòu)方案。

在具體功能的實(shí)現(xiàn)上,我們遇到了一些意想不到的問(wèn)題。例如,在數(shù)據(jù)庫(kù)設(shè)計(jì)和優(yōu)化方面,我們需要確保系統(tǒng)的高并發(fā)性能和數(shù)據(jù)的一致性。這需要我們進(jìn)行大量的測(cè)試和調(diào)優(yōu)。在這個(gè)過(guò)程中,我們不得不?反復(fù)修改代碼,進(jìn)行多次性能測(cè)試,才最終實(shí)現(xiàn)了理想的效果。

鶴的開(kāi)發(fā)日記功能與特色

在軟件開(kāi)發(fā)領(lǐng)域,開(kāi)發(fā)日記是一種記錄和分析開(kāi)發(fā)過(guò)程的重要工具,它不僅幫助開(kāi)發(fā)者追蹤項(xiàng)目進(jìn)展,還能為項(xiàng)目管理提供重要數(shù)據(jù)支持。千鶴的開(kāi)發(fā)日記作為一款高度定制化的工具,具有以下幾個(gè)顯著特點(diǎn):

高度定制化:千鶴開(kāi)發(fā)日記允許用戶(hù)根據(jù)個(gè)人和團(tuán)隊(duì)的實(shí)際需求進(jìn)行高度定制化設(shè)置。用戶(hù)可以自定義日志模板、字段和提醒事項(xiàng),使得?日記記錄更加貼近實(shí)際工作需求。

實(shí)時(shí)協(xié)作:千鶴開(kāi)發(fā)日記支持實(shí)時(shí)協(xié)作,團(tuán)隊(duì)成員可以在同一個(gè)平臺(tái)上共享日志,并?進(jìn)行即時(shí)討論和反饋。這種即時(shí)性極大地提高了團(tuán)隊(duì)溝通效率。

數(shù)據(jù)分析與報(bào)表:該工具內(nèi)置了強(qiáng)大的數(shù)據(jù)分析功能,可以生成詳細(xì)的項(xiàng)目進(jìn)度報(bào)表和績(jī)效分析。通過(guò)這些數(shù)據(jù),項(xiàng)目經(jīng)理可以更好地把握項(xiàng)目狀態(tài),進(jìn)行科學(xué)決策。

集成與擴(kuò)展性:千鶴開(kāi)發(fā)日記支持與多種開(kāi)發(fā)工具和項(xiàng)目管理系統(tǒng)的集成,例如JIRA、Git等。這種高度的集成性使得它可以無(wú)縫地嵌入到現(xiàn)有的開(kāi)發(fā)流程中,增強(qiáng)了工具的擴(kuò)展性。

測(cè)試階段

在初稿完成之前,我們進(jìn)行了全面的測(cè)試,包括功能測(cè)試、性能測(cè)試和安全測(cè)試。在功能測(cè)試中,我們逐一驗(yàn)證了每一個(gè)功能?椋繁F浞閑棖笪牡。在性能測(cè)試中,我們模擬高并發(fā)場(chǎng)景,測(cè)試系統(tǒng)的響應(yīng)速度和穩(wěn)定性。在安全測(cè)試中,我們進(jìn)行了滲透測(cè)試,發(fā)現(xiàn)并修復(fù)了所有的安全漏洞。

測(cè)試與優(yōu)化:確保質(zhì)量

開(kāi)發(fā)初期過(guò)后,我們進(jìn)入了測(cè)試與優(yōu)化階段。這一階段的工作非常關(guān)鍵,因?yàn)樗苯雨P(guān)系到平臺(tái)的最終質(zhì)量和用戶(hù)體驗(yàn)。我們進(jìn)行了全面的功能測(cè)試、性能測(cè)試和安全測(cè)試,確保每一個(gè)?槎寄芡昝澇誦。

在測(cè)試過(guò)程中,我們發(fā)現(xiàn)了許多潛在的問(wèn)題,并逐一進(jìn)行了修復(fù)和優(yōu)化。例如,我們發(fā)現(xiàn)某些功能在高并發(fā)情況下表現(xiàn)不佳,于是進(jìn)行了優(yōu)化,使其能夠更好地應(yīng)對(duì)大規(guī)模用戶(hù)訪(fǎng)問(wèn)。我們對(duì)數(shù)據(jù)庫(kù)進(jìn)行了重構(gòu),提高了數(shù)據(jù)查詢(xún)的速度和效率。

這一階段的工作非常艱辛,但也充滿(mǎn)了成就感。每一個(gè)問(wèn)題的解決,都讓我們離最終上線(xiàn)更近了一步。

初期設(shè)計(jì)

在項(xiàng)目初期,我們進(jìn)行了深入的需求分析和市場(chǎng)調(diào)研,明確了項(xiàng)目的核心價(jià)值和功能定位。我們組建了一個(gè)高效的團(tuán)隊(duì),包括架構(gòu)師、前端工程師、后端開(kāi)發(fā)工程師和測(cè)試工程師。團(tuán)隊(duì)成員在開(kāi)始前,先進(jìn)行了一系列的技術(shù)交流和頭腦風(fēng)暴,確定了項(xiàng)目的整體架構(gòu)設(shè)計(jì)和技術(shù)選型。

我們決定采用微服務(wù)架構(gòu),以提高系統(tǒng)的擴(kuò)展性和靈活性。在前端,我們選擇了React框架,通過(guò)組件化開(kāi)發(fā),保證代碼的可維護(hù)性和可復(fù)用性。在后端,我們選擇了SpringBoot框架,并?結(jié)合MySQL數(shù)據(jù)庫(kù),確保數(shù)據(jù)的安?全和高效處理。

開(kāi)發(fā)階段與技術(shù)挑戰(zhàn)

在開(kāi)發(fā)過(guò)程中,我們遇到了許多技術(shù)挑戰(zhàn)。例如,前端組在使用React時(shí),需要處理大量的異步請(qǐng)求和狀態(tài)管理問(wèn)題。我們通過(guò)引入Redux庫(kù),并結(jié)合React的組件化特點(diǎn),最終實(shí)現(xiàn)了高效的狀態(tài)管理。

在后端開(kāi)發(fā)中,我們面臨著數(shù)據(jù)庫(kù)設(shè)計(jì)的復(fù)雜性。為了確保數(shù)據(jù)的完整性和一致性,我們采用了分布式事務(wù)機(jī)制,并使用MongoDB的集群技術(shù),保證了系統(tǒng)的高可用性和數(shù)據(jù)的安?全性。

容器化部署也是一個(gè)難點(diǎn)。我們通過(guò)Docker技術(shù),將各個(gè)服務(wù)進(jìn)行了獨(dú)立的容器化,并使用Kubernetes進(jìn)行管理,確保了系統(tǒng)的可擴(kuò)展性和穩(wěn)定性。

技術(shù)選型與架構(gòu)設(shè)計(jì)

在項(xiàng)目初期,技術(shù)選型和架構(gòu)設(shè)計(jì)是至關(guān)重要的環(huán)節(jié)。我們需要選擇適合項(xiàng)目需求的技術(shù)棧,并確保系統(tǒng)的架構(gòu)能夠支持?未來(lái)的擴(kuò)展和優(yōu)化。經(jīng)過(guò)多次頭腦風(fēng)暴和技術(shù)評(píng)估,我們決定采用微服務(wù)架構(gòu),并選擇以下技術(shù)棧:

前端:使用React框架,結(jié)合Redux進(jìn)行狀態(tài)管理。后端:采用Node.js和Express.js搭建服務(wù)器,使用MongoDB作為數(shù)據(jù)庫(kù)。容器化:使用Docker進(jìn)行容器化部署,以提高系統(tǒng)的可移植性和可維護(hù)性。云服務(wù):選擇AWS作為云服務(wù)提供商,以便更好地利用云計(jì)算資源。

這些選型不僅能夠滿(mǎn)足當(dāng)前的?項(xiàng)目需求,還為未來(lái)的擴(kuò)展和優(yōu)化提供了堅(jiān)實(shí)的基礎(chǔ)。

展望未來(lái)

千鶴項(xiàng)目的初稿完成,是我們團(tuán)隊(duì)共同努力的結(jié)果,也是未來(lái)發(fā)展的起點(diǎn)。我們將繼續(xù)保持高度的敏捷和創(chuàng)新,不斷推出新的功能和優(yōu)化,力爭(zhēng)為用戶(hù)提供更加智能、便捷的解決方案。

在這個(gè)快速變化的時(shí)代,只有不斷學(xué)習(xí)和創(chuàng)新,我們才能在激烈的市場(chǎng)競(jìng)爭(zhēng)中立于不敗之地。千鶴項(xiàng)目,只是一個(gè)開(kāi)始,我們將在未來(lái)的日子里,繼續(xù)迎接更多的?挑戰(zhàn),創(chuàng)造更多的價(jià)值。

校對(duì):劉俊英(p6mu9CWFoIx7YFddy4eQTuEboRc9VR7b9b)

責(zé)任編輯: 劉欣然
為你推薦
用戶(hù)評(píng)論
登錄后可以發(fā)言
網(wǎng)友評(píng)論僅供其表達(dá)個(gè)人看法,并不表明證券時(shí)報(bào)立場(chǎng)
暫無(wú)評(píng)論